Problem
A dock shares its upstream connection with a high-bandwidth display path, reducing effective storage throughput during simultaneous editing and monitoring.
Solution
Root Cause / Diagnostic:
Thunderbolt 3/4 links allocate display traffic (DisplayPort 1.4 HBR3) with absolute priority over PCIe data tunneling within the shared 40Gbps physical link. Driving an uncompressed 5K or dual 4K 60Hz display consumes up to 25Gbps of the available bandwidth, compressing available storage bandwidth down from ~3000MB/s to less than 1500MB/s during simultaneous playback.
Actionable Fix:
1. Independent Display Routing: Connect the high-resolution editing monitor directly to a dedicated HDMI/DisplayPort or separate GPU Thunderbolt port on the host computer.
2. Display Stream Compression (DSC) Enablement: Enable DSC on the monitor and GPU to compress display bandwidth requirements without sacrificing visual fidelity.
3. Simultaneous Transfer Verification: Run a storage speed test while playing a 4K timeline on the external monitor to verify throughput remains above 2400MB/s.
Pro Tip:
Dual 4K monitors plugged into your storage dock will eat more than half your Thunderbolt bandwidth; connect displays directly to your workstation GPU to preserve maximum speed for your editing drives.
